01825578023 Summary (Read all comments)
Phone number βοΈ 01825578023 π is reported as a persistent HMRC-related scam number targeting individuals with automated calls using prerecorded messages, often featuring unfamiliar or American accents. Callers falsely claim legal action or tax debts, urging recipients to respond or pay. Many users experience silence upon answering or immediate hang-ups when challenged. The number is widely recognised as fraudulent, with multiple reports of blocking and official blocking actions by service providers. Despite efforts to curb activity, calls continue, frequently from varying numbers and area codes. Recipients are strongly advised not to interact with such calls and to report the number to appropriate authorities to avoid potential financial or personal information risks.

About 01 Numbers
These num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by residential and commercial properties. Sometimes referred to as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Numerous service providers offer call packages that provide free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are dependent on the chosen calling plan, with a lot of pl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
